Reading

Then the Lord spoke to Job out of the storm. He said: “Who is this that obscures my plans with words without knowledge?

Brace yourself. I will question you, and you shall answer me.

“Where were you when I laid the earth’s foundation? Tell me, if you understand. Who marked off its dimensions? Who stretched a measuring line across it?

On what were its footings set, or who laid its cornerstone—while the morning stars sang together and all the angels shouted for joy?”

—Job 38 (OT)
